Ingredients List
Here’s everything you’ll need to whip up this delightful one pot cheeseburger macaroni. I promise, these ingredients are simple and likely to be found in your kitchen already!
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 cups macaroni pasta
- 4 cups beef broth
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 cup milk
- 2 tablespoons ketchup
- 1 tablespoon mustard
- Salt and pepper to taste

How to Prepare One Pot Cheeseburger Macaroni
Alright, let’s get cooking! I’ll walk you through each step of making this one pot cheeseburger macaroni. It’s super straightforward, and I promise you’ll feel like a kitchen pro by the end of it!
Step 1: Brown the Meat and Onion
First things first, grab a large pot and set it over medium heat. Toss in that 1 lb of ground beef along with the diced onion. You’ll want to break up the beef with a spatula as it cooks. Keep an eye on it; the beef should turn a nice brown color and the onions will become soft and translucent. This usually takes about 5-7 minutes. Don’t forget to drain any excess fat afterward—just tilt the pot slightly and use a ladle to scoop it out. We want all that flavor without the greasiness!
Step 2: Add Ingredients
Once the meat and onions are looking fab, it’s time to add the rest! Stir in 2 cups of macaroni pasta, 4 cups of beef broth, 2 tablespoons of ketchup, and 1 tablespoon of mustard. Sprinkle in some salt and pepper to taste, too. Give everything a good stir to make sure it’s well mixed. This is where the magic starts to happen, and your kitchen will start smelling amazing!
Step 3: Boil and Simmer
Now, bring the mixture to a boil. This is the exciting part! Once it’s bubbling away, reduce the heat to a simmer. Cover the pot and let it cook for about 10-12 minutes, stirring occasionally. This is important—stirring helps prevent the pasta from sticking to the bottom of the pot. Just be patient; soon you’ll have perfectly cooked macaroni soaking up all that delicious flavor!
Step 4: Combine Milk and Cheese
When the pasta is tender and cooked through, it’s time to turn up the creaminess factor! Pour in 1 cup of milk and add 1 cup of shredded cheddar cheese. Stir gently until the cheese has melted into a gooey, cheesy delight. Trust me, this is the moment you’ll want to dive right in, but hold on for just a sec!
Step 5: Serve and Enjoy
Finally, it’s time to serve up your one pot cheeseburger macaroni! Scoop it into bowls while it’s still hot and, if you’re feeling fancy, sprinkle a little extra cheese on top or even some chopped green onions for a pop of color. Storage & Reheating Instructions
Alright, let’s talk about what to do with those delicious leftovers! You definitely don’t want to waste any of this cheesy goodness. Storing and reheating your one pot cheeseburger macaroni is super simple, and I’ve got all the tips you need to keep it tasting amazing!
First off, once you’ve enjoyed your meal, let any leftovers cool down a bit before storing them. It’ll help prevent condensation in your container, which means your macaroni stays nice and fresh.
For storage, I recommend using airtight containers. Glass containers are perfect because they don’t stain and are easy to reheat in the microwave. If you don’t have those, plastic containers work just fine too—just make sure they’re labeled as microwave-safe!
Your one pot cheeseburger macaroni will keep well in the refrigerator for about 3-4 days. If you want to keep it longer, you can also freeze it! Just portion it out into individual servings and freeze in airtight containers or freezer bags. It should be good for about 2-3 months in the freezer.
Now, when it comes time to reheat, if you’re pulling it from the fridge, just pop it in the microwave for about 1-2 minutes, stirring halfway through, until it’s heated all the way through. You might want to add a splash of milk before reheating to bring back that creamy texture—trust me, it makes all the difference!
If you’re reheating from frozen, let it thaw in the fridge overnight first, and then follow the same microwave instructions. Or, you can reheat it on the stovetop over low heat, adding a little milk as needed while stirring to keep it creamy.

One Pot Cheeseburger Macaroni: 5 Steps to Cheesy Bliss
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: None
Description
A simple and delicious one pot cheeseburger macaroni recipe. Perfect for a quick meal.
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 cups macaroni pasta
- 4 cups beef broth
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 cup milk
- 2 tablespoons ketchup
- 1 tablespoon mustard
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- In a large pot, brown the ground beef and onion over medium heat.
- Drain excess fat.
- Add macaroni, beef broth, ketchup, mustard, salt, and pepper.
-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 10-12 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Once the pasta is cooked, stir in milk and cheese until melted.
- Serve hot and enjoy your meal!
Notes
- Make sure to stir frequently to prevent sticking.
- You can substitute ground turkey for a lighter option.
- Feel free to add vegetables for extra nutrition.
